Car Parts And Suppliers Businesses in SCOTTS VALLEY, CALIFORNIA

There are 2 Car Parts And Suppliers (classified under Shopping & Stores -> Auto And Home Supply Stores) business locations listed in Scotts Valley, California. To view directions, website links, hours, ratings and additional profile details please select the location you are interested in from the list below.


Pages: 1
Np Automtv
6012 Scotts Valley Drive
Winchester Auto Store Inc
5346 Scotts Valley Drive East